Lic Housing Finance Ltd. Shareholding Update: An Examination of Financial Performance for FY (Q4-Mar 2023-2024)

Lic Housing Finance Ltd. has unveiled its latest shareholding reports, covering the quarter and the first half of the fiscal year ending on (Q4-Mar 2023-2024).This comprehensive report offers a deep dive into the company’s shareholding landscape, including details on Promoters, promoter groups, Foreign investors, public investors, and government entities. Through meticulous comparative analysis, it tracks the evolution of shareholding percentages and quantities, highlighting any shifts in ownership dynamics. Investors gain invaluable insights into the company’s ownership structure and the evolving investment landscape.
Shareholder Name Previous Quater Quantity(In Crores) Current Quater Quantity(In Crores) Previous Quater Shares(in %) Current Quater Shares(in %) Quater to Quater Difference
Promoters 24.88 24.88 45.24 45.24 0
Public 30.12 30.12 11.08 10.18 -0.9 %
DII 11.97 12.10 21.77 21.99 +0.22 %
FII 12.05 12.43 21.91 22.59 +0.68 %
Government 0.00 0.00 0 0 0
Promoters shareholding remained stable, at 45.24% in both December 2023 and March 2024. This indicates that the promoters’ control over the company did not change during this period. The percentage of shares held by the public decreased from 11.08% in December 2023 to 10.18% in March 2024.This reduction indicates that the public’s stake in the company diminished during this period.DIIs (Domestic Institutional Investors) shareholding increased from 21.77% in December 2023 to 21.99% in March 2024 , indicating that domestic institutions increased their stake in the company by 0.22% . FIIs (Foreign Institutional Investors): There was a significant increase from 21.91% in December 2023 to 22.59% in March 2024. This suggests that foreign institutions grew their investments 0.68 in the company during the quarter. During quater from December 2023 to March 2024, Goverenment ownership remained steady at 0%.This indicates that the government’s stake in the company remained consistent during this period.
